Lady Blues Notch Home Sweep of Monmouth

JACKSONVILLE, Ill. – The Illinois College volleyball team came up big play after big play on Tuesday night, sweeping the Monmouth Scots in three sets (25-23, 25-22, 25-20). The Lady Blues scored the last two points of the first set after it was tied at 23-23, then came from behind in both the second and third sets to secure their first Midwest Conference victory of the season. IC improves to 7-10 (1-3 MWC).

Holly Crocher was once again integral for Illinois College. The senior middle blocker hit .556 in the match with 10 kills, two solo blocks and two block assists. Lisa Lowry had nine kills and two solo blocks as well.

The largest lead for either team in the first set came for Illinois College with a score of 10-7. Monmouth quickly regrouped and the score would be tied eight times from that point on. The last tie came for the Scots after Quincy Merritt laid down a kill to make it 23-23. Though Monmouth had the serve, an error followed by an attack error gave the final two points to the Lady Blues for a 1-0 lead.

Illinois College struggled out of the gates in the second set and fell behind 5-0. A Merritt service error opened the doors for the Lady Blues to rattle off six straight points however, giving IC an 8-7 edge and forcing Monmouth into a timeout. Though momentum was on IC's side for a time, the Scots managed to keep it close and a Merritt kill sliced the Illinois College lead to 23-22. Two important kills from Lowry and Courtney Louveau followed for the Lady Blues, giving them the set.

Monmouth again stormed out to a lead in the third set, going up 4-0. Again, down 7-2, Illinois College scored six straight to take an 8-7 advantage on the Scots. Monmouth regained a 14-12 lead but the Lady Blues scored five straight points, with Lowry supplying two of the kills in that span to take a 17-14 lead. Monmouth was able to pull within one point at 20-19, but two Crocher kills helped IC regain a comfortable margin and Lowry ended it with a solo block of a Merritt attack.

Louveau led the Lady Blues with 18 assists in the match and had a solid all-around performance with seven kills and nine digs. Allison Perkins led IC with 16 digs and Eve Bahler produced a double-double of 11 assists and 10 digs. Brenna Garland was solid defensively as well with 12 digs.

Illinois College returns to Sherman Gymnasium on Oct. 9 for another MWC match, hosting Beloit College at 7 p.m.
